Austin Reaves Returns to Lineup in Lakers' Rout of the Nets

  • Lakers guard Austin Reaves is slated to return Tuesday in Brooklyn after missing 19 games, with JJ Redick saying he will come off the bench on a minutes restriction.
  • After a late-December setback, the injury was announced on January 2 with a four-week re-evaluation, following a grade two calf strain and missed games. Redick said Reaves needs `100% confidence` before returning.
  • ESPN reported that Reaves has been ramping up in `stay ready` sessions and participated in warmups on Tuesday, feeling good enough to play.
  • With the standings tight, the Lakers sit sixth at 29-19 and are 3.5 games back of the Spurs, so Reaves’s return could provide a timely boost, Redick said.
  • The team stressed caution, noting a four-to-six week window to preserve explosiveness, and Tuesday closed the Lakers' eight-game road trip with no trade-deadline moves.

Austin Reaves returns to Lakers against Nets after calf strain sidelined him since Christmas

Austin Reaves will play for the Los Angeles Lakers on Tuesday night in Brooklyn after missing the last 19 games with a strained left calf.
